The Built-In, Risk-Free Trial
Blue Buffalo does not run a direct mail sample program. Instead, the company provides a 100 % satisfaction guarantee covering every dry food, wet food, and treat line.
Purchase any size bag, keep the receipt, and save the unused portion.
If your dog rejects the food, return the remainder to the retailer for a full refund or exchange. This policy functions like a large-format sample that costs nothing in the end.
The Core Reasons Blue Buffalo Attracts Global Attention
Sampling makes sense only when the product looks promising, and Blue Buffalo delivers several compelling advantages:
- Real meat leads every ingredient list—no poultry by-product meals appear in any recipe.
- Grain-free and whole-grain options coexist, covering dogs that tolerate brown rice as well as those needing limited-ingredient diets.
- LifeSource Bits™ supply cold-formed vitamins and antioxidants, supporting immune health without the heat damage common in many kibbles.
- Six-point quality checks guard consistency through supplier audits, in-house analysis, and third-party lab verification.
- Manufacturing occurs in modern U.S. facilities, yet distribution reaches retailers worldwide.

After the Taste Test: Evaluating Results and Next Moves
During the first feeding and the forty-eight hours that follow, assess appetite, stool consistency, energy levels, and skin comfort.
Record quick notes, including how rapidly the bowl empties and any signs of itching or digestive upset.
A positive response implies moving to a full bag, ideally using the included coupon. Negative reactions justify invoking the satisfaction guarantee for a refund and consulting a veterinarian before selecting another formula.
